Q: How do I follow a request across our microservices?

A: Every inbound call to Quillbrook gets a trace token that all downstream services (Mossgate, Fernley, the billing shim) propagate in headers. Pop it into the Spyglass dashboard and you'll see the full hop chain. Quick heads-up for the sync: the staging Spyglass instance is locked down this week, so sign in with the recovery passphrase below.

vault phrase of taweg-kafof = oliax-zorael

## Onboarding: Quietude Alert Deduplicator

Welcome to the Pagerline team! Quietude is our dedup layer that collapses duplicate on-call alerts before they hit your phone at 3am. You'll mostly touch the rules engine, but occasionally you'll need to push a config bundle to the Harborfield cluster. Config pushes are signed — the deploy tooling refuses anything unsigned, no exceptions, even for "tiny" changes. Ask in the team channel if the verifier complains. To get started, add the current deploy key to your keyring; it's included below.

deploy key for yajop-fahop: bky3_h1v

Hey — handing off the SplitDeck assignment service before my leave. The bucketing logic in assigner.go is the bit to review carefully; hashing changed to avoid the skew Tamsin found. Experiments re-randomize on version bump, which is intentional. Everything else is plumbing. The staging config the tests run against is pasted below.

settings of yahaf-tahop:
jorox:
  pin: 5851
  tenant: noveth
  seal: seal_7ddb5c42
  metrics_host: metrics.jorox.ordinnet.example
  standby_team: wenax
  escalation: oliath-feneth
  nonce: 552548

Subject: Office Move — Friday Run

Hello Dispatch,

For the Brindlewood office relocation on Friday, the van should arrive at the old Carthew Lane premises by 08:30 sharp. All filing cabinets are sealed and numbered; the driver must check each against the manifest before loading. Please brief the driver carefully on the following hand-over requirement.

handover note for yagef-bagep: the drudor pelius courier leaves the kasdor zorvan norir ledger at gate 8016 under passcode 755406